Felbamate-d4 usage and description
Felbamate D4 is a deuterated isotopologue of Felbamate, a medication used in the treatment of epilepsy. It is a white crystalline powder that is soluble in water and methanol. Felbamate D4 is a stable isotope of Felbamate that is used in pharmacokinetic studies to determine the metabolic fate of the drug in the body.
Felbamate D4 is a broad-spectrum antiepileptic drug that is used to control seizures in patients with epilepsy. It works by increasing the activity of GABA, a neurotransmitter that helps to regulate brain activity. Felbamate D4 is used in combination with other antiepileptic drugs to achieve better seizure control.
The chemical formula of Felbamate D4 is C11H5D4N2O4. It has a molecular weight of 253.27 g/mol. The deuterium substitution in Felbamate D4 is non-radioactive and does not affect the pharmacological properties of the drug.
Felbamate D4 is metabolized in the liver by cytochrome P450 enzymes. It has a half-life of approximately 20 hours and is eliminated from the body primarily through the kidneys.
